I want to upgrade my motherboard. Currently I have an Intel D945GCNL motherboard. :heink:

http://allaboutmotherboards.com/intelmotherboards-2611200709263713-1.shtml

The processor is Intel Core 2 duo E6400 (2.13Ghz).

Currently I,m looking for the Asus G41 series motherboard which I can easily find from a local store at low cost.

http://www.asus.com/Motherboards/Intel_Socket_775/P5G41TM_LX/#overview

Simply I want to know whether the Asus G41TM LX is better than Intel D945GCNL.................

And whether it can handle my current Graphic Card Sapphire Radeon HD 5450. ........................ :D


 
Solution
Yes. The g41 is a newer chipset, but don't expect any better performance unless you overclock the cpu. Be sure your power supply is decent if you want to overclock. Otherwise, you'll have random reboots and other issues. That graphics card should work with at least a 400w respectable ps, such as antec, corsair, or ocz. Cheaper brands like powman may not work.
